Output d31dc714ae9bb3ccfa718599af40197eb003e65890546ddc074d5f1b82e382eb:158

value
11540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6b203249c564dbf08b5ae6eef430182e8cb7575e61af8c7a0f1f2e4147ad64d
address
bc1pc6eqxfyu2exm7z944ehw7scpst5vkat4ucd033aq78ewg9r66exsamc8a0
transaction
d31dc714ae9bb3ccfa718599af40197eb003e65890546ddc074d5f1b82e382eb
spent
true